El Salvador
Support the promotion and development of inclusive schools in El Salvador
The project "Support the promotion and development of inclusive schools in El Salvador", funded by the Italian Ministry of Foreign Affairs, has been proposed by the Faculty of Education, University of Bologna in collaboration with Educaid and in partnership with MINED (Ministerio de Educación de El Salvador). Following the positive results achieved in the pilot experience of the Italian Cooperation in El Salvador, "Realización de un complejo de tipo experimental inclusive education" (which many experts have helped the University of Bologna), the Faculty of Education with the support of Mined, aims to promote a model of inclusive schools to help combat social exclusion and to promote appreciation of diversity and good practice through the empowerment of local educational institutions. From the perspective inclusive education, school is the place where you include all types of diversity to promote participation in the economic, social, cultural and political community by children and girls at serious risk of social exclusion, determined by situations of poverty and discrimination of a socio-cultural and physical. Through inclusive education can overcome the handicap deficit produced by psycho-physical and social conditions of severe disadvantage to allow access to education for all boys and girls. The project provides training for government officials and teachers to develop a model of inclusive schools in El Salvador. In the course of the initiative will be carried out workshops, training seminars and technical sections in collaboration with the local Ministry of Education. There are also plans to create a platform for distance education and the creation of a national observatory on the identification of good practices that are local, whose work fits into the strategic plan of national educational policies.
